Professional Quality Roofing doesn’t install products we don’t trust. Duro-Last is the best single-ply PVC roofing membrane available and can be custom-fabricated to suit specific applications. 

 

Made from lightweight yet durable polyvinyl chloride, or PVC, Duro-Last membranes are low maintenance, highly reflective, watertight, and withstand harsh chemicals, fires, and high winds. These attributes make it the perfect solution for new construction low-slope roofing systems.

Duro-Last Roofing is ideal for flat and low-sloped applications. In addition to the durability of its PVC membrane, it has several other benefits:

  • low maintenance
  • watertight
  • highly reflective
  • resistant to chemicals, fire and high winds, as well as.

New Commercial Roof Installation Benefits 

New construction roofing enables you to select the best roofing system and materials for the structure being built. Having options opens up a wealth of benefits that can save a lot of money over the long haul.

 

  • Better Protection: A newly constructed roof provides superior protection from the elements, keeping your structure as well as the equipment and personnel inside safe.
  • Advanced Features: Roofing technology has changed significantly over the years, and innovative features can be utilized. Membranes are now more aesthetically pleasing, offer better wind- and water-resistance, and eco-friendliness.
  • Peace Of Mind: After a new roof installation, you get a warranty with excellent coverage. Depending on the situation, you may avoid paying for minor repairs for years.
  • Lower Insurance Premiums: Often, new construction roofing opens you up to a lower monthly insurance premium. Contact your insurance agent as soon as possible.
  • Less Maintenance: Roofing materials degrade over time, becoming weaker than they once were. This results in ongoing maintenance, which can get costly. You won’t have to deal with these issues with a newly installed roof for years. It’s still important to perform inspections, especially following storms. The best way to keep problems away is to catch things early.
  • Better Aesthetic Appeal: A primary benefit of new construction roofing is curb appeal. As one of the most visible parts of a structure, the materials selected can change the structure’s look and feel.
  • Energy Efficiency: A new roof helps to maintain indoor temperatures. The work environment is more comfortable and energy costs drop.
  • Increased Worth: A new roof increases a business’ value. For landlords or property managers, a new roof goes a long way to attracting tenants.
